First wildlife overpass on Interstate 5

This will be the first wildlife overpass in Oregon and the only one along the I-5 corridor that connects Mexico to Canada. The Oregon Department of Transportation (ODOT) has received a federal grant of over $33 million to construct a wildlife overpass on Interstate 5 in southern Oregon, near the Cascade-Siskiyou National Monument.
